How to Reach Deming, United States

Deming is a charming city located in the southwestern part of New Mexico, United States. Whether you are planning a visit or considering moving to this beautiful destination, here are some ways to reach Deming:

By Air:

The closest major airport to Deming is the El Paso International Airport (ELP), located approximately 90 miles southeast of the city. Upon arrival at the airport, you can rent a car or hire a taxi to reach Deming. Several major airlines operate regular flights to and from El Paso, connecting it to various cities across the United States.

By Car:

Deming is easily accessible by car as it is situated along Interstate 10, which runs east-west through the southern part of the state. If you are driving from nearby cities like Tucson, Arizona, or Las Cruces, New Mexico, you can take Interstate 10 and follow the signs to Deming. The city is also well-connected to other major highways, making it convenient to reach by road.

By Bus:

If you prefer traveling by bus, there are several bus companies that operate routes to Deming. Greyhound, for instance, offers services to and from Deming, connecting it to various cities in the region. You can check their website or contact their customer service for schedules and ticket information.

By Train:

While Deming does not have its own train station, you can still reach the city by train. The nearest Amtrak station is located in Lordsburg, approximately 40 miles west of Deming. From Lordsburg, you can take a taxi or rent a car to reach your final destination in Deming.

No matter which mode of transportation you choose, reaching Deming is relatively straightforward. The city's convenient location and good connectivity make it easily accessible for visitors and residents alike.

Getting to know Deming

Deming is a small city located in Luna County, New Mexico, United States. Situated in the southwestern part of the state, Deming is known for its rich history, diverse culture, and stunning natural beauty. The city is nestled in the high desert region, surrounded by picturesque mountains and vast open spaces.

With a population of approximately 14,000 residents, Deming offers a close-knit community atmosphere and a relaxed pace of life. The city has a strong agricultural heritage, with farming and ranching playing a significant role in its economy. Deming is famous for its production of chile peppers, pecans, and cotton, which are grown in the fertile lands surrounding the city.

In addition to its agricultural roots, Deming also has a thriving tourism industry. The city is a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ts due to its proximity to several national parks, including the Gila National Forest and City of Rocks State Park. These natural attractions offer opportunities for camping, hiking, bird-watching, and stargazing.

Deming is also home to several historical and cultural sites, showcasing its rich heritage. The Deming Luna Mimbres Museum houses a vast collection of artifacts and exhibits that depict the history and culture of the region. The city also hosts various festivals and events throughout the year, celebrating its diverse cultural influences, including Mexican, Native American, and Western traditions.
